Unveiling the Hottest Fitness Trends UAE is Embracing in 2025

Asher Ives July 20, 2025 12 min read
Diverse people intensely exercising in modern UAE gym.

The fitness scene in the UAE is always changing, and 2025 is looking like a big year for new trends. People here are really getting into different ways to stay active, from working out outside to using cool new tech. It’s not just about hitting the gym anymore; it’s about finding fun, effective ways to move your body and feel good. We’re seeing lots of exciting Fitness trends UAE residents are picking up, and it’s all about making health a part of everyday life.

Embracing Outdoor Fitness Adventures

It’s 2025, and the UAE is all about taking workouts outside! Forget being stuck in a gym; people are craving fresh air and sunshine. This trend is fueled by a desire to connect with nature and enjoy the beautiful landscapes the Emirates have to offer. Outdoor fitness is no longer just a trend; it’s a lifestyle choice.

Desert Trail Running Popularity

Desert trail running is seriously taking off. More and more people are hitting the dunes for a challenging and scenic workout. Organized races and group runs are popping up all over, catering to both beginners and experienced runners. It’s a great way to test your endurance and see some incredible views. Plus, the soft sand is surprisingly kind to your joints. You can find local fitness hubs to join a group.

Beachfront Yoga and Pilates

Imagine doing your sun salutations with the sound of waves crashing nearby. Beachfront yoga and Pilates classes are booming. Studios are offering sessions right on the sand, and it’s a super popular way to start the day or unwind after work. The gentle breeze and calming ocean sounds really enhance the mind-body connection. It’s not just about the workout; it’s about the whole experience. Gadz training shoes are great for this.

Water Sports for Core Strength

Kayaking, paddleboarding, and even windsurfing are becoming go-to activities for building core strength. These aren’t just fun water sports; they’re serious workouts that engage your entire body. Many fitness centers now offer specialized classes to help you improve your technique and get the most out of your time on the water. Plus, it’s a fantastic way to beat the heat and enjoy the beautiful coastline.

The shift towards outdoor fitness reflects a broader movement towards holistic well-being. People are realizing that exercise isn’t just about physical health; it’s also about mental and emotional well-being. Being outdoors, surrounded by nature, has a profound impact on our overall sense of happiness and vitality.

Technological Integration in Workouts

It’s wild to see how much tech is changing fitness here in the UAE. Forget just running on a treadmill; we’re talking about full-on digital immersion. People are really embracing these new tools to get the most out of their workouts. It’s not just a trend; it’s a total transformation of how we approach exercise.

Wearable Tech for Performance Tracking

Wearable tech is everywhere, and it’s not just about counting steps anymore. We’re talking about advanced sensors that track everything from heart rate variability to sleep patterns. This data helps people understand their bodies better and optimize their training. For example, athlete monitoring is becoming more precise, allowing for personalized training plans. It’s like having a personal trainer on your wrist, constantly monitoring and adjusting to your needs.

AI-Powered Personalized Training

AI is making waves in personalized fitness. These systems analyze your data from wearables and fitness apps to create custom workout plans. They adjust in real-time based on your performance and recovery. It’s like having a super-smart coach that knows exactly what you need, when you need it.

  • AI analyzes your fitness data to create personalized workout plans.
  • The system adjusts workouts in real-time based on your performance.
  • AI can also provide nutritional guidance based on your activity levels.

Virtual Reality Fitness Experiences

VR fitness is taking off in a big way. Imagine cycling through the Swiss Alps or boxing in a virtual ring, all from the comfort of your living room. These immersive experiences make working out more engaging and fun. It’s a great way to break the monotony of traditional workouts and stay motivated. Plus, with advancements in haptic feedback, you can actually feel the workout, making it even more realistic. Tactical movements can be practiced in a safe, controlled environment, enhancing skill development.

The integration of technology into fitness is not just about gadgets; it’s about creating a more personalized, effective, and engaging workout experience. It’s about using data and innovation to help people achieve their fitness goals in a way that’s tailored to their individual needs and preferences.

Holistic Wellness and Mindful Movement

It’s not just about crushing your fitness goals anymore; it’s about feeling good, inside and out. People are realizing that fitness is more than just physical exertion; it’s about connecting with your mind and body. This trend is huge in the UAE right now, and it’s only going to get bigger in 2025.

Mind-Body Connection Through Meditation

Meditation is going mainstream, and it’s not just for yogis anymore. People are using meditation to reduce stress, improve focus, and boost their overall well-being. There are tons of apps and studios offering guided meditations, making it easier than ever to incorporate this practice into your daily routine. I’ve been trying to meditate for 10 minutes every morning, and it’s made a noticeable difference in my stress levels. You can even find unique yoga experiences that incorporate meditation.

Stress Reduction with Breathwork

Breathwork is another powerful tool for managing stress and improving mental clarity. It involves simple breathing exercises that can calm your nervous system and bring you into the present moment. The best part is that you can do it anywhere, anytime.

Here are some popular breathwork techniques:

  • Box Breathing: Inhale for 4 seconds, hold for 4 seconds, exhale for 4 seconds, hold for 4 seconds. Repeat.
  • Diaphragmatic Breathing: Focus on breathing deeply into your belly, rather than your chest.
  • Alternate Nostril Breathing: Close one nostril and inhale through the other, then switch nostrils and exhale. Repeat.

I started doing breathwork before bed, and it’s helped me fall asleep so much faster. It’s amazing how something so simple can have such a big impact.

Nutrition Coaching for Optimal Health

What you eat plays a huge role in how you feel, both physically and mentally. More people are seeking out nutrition coaching to learn how to fuel their bodies properly. It’s not just about weight loss; it’s about eating for energy, focus, and overall health. Personalized plans are key, because what works for one person might not work for another. It’s about finding what makes you feel your best. Customized training considers an athlete’s strengths, weaknesses, and goals, ensuring training is precisely targeted to maximize potential. This personalized approach also incorporates nutritional and mental conditioning advice, addressing the holistic needs of the athlete to optimize overall well-being and performance.

Community-Driven Fitness Initiatives

Fitness isn’t just about individual goals anymore; it’s about connecting with others and building a supportive environment. In the UAE, this trend is really taking off, with people finding motivation and enjoyment through shared fitness experiences. It’s less about isolated gym sessions and more about being part of something bigger.

Group Challenges and Competitions

Group challenges are everywhere! From step challenges using wearable tech to intense CrossFit competitions, people are pushing themselves harder when they’re part of a team. These challenges create a sense of camaraderie and accountability, making fitness more fun and less of a chore. Many local gyms and studios are organizing their own internal competitions, and there are also larger, city-wide events that draw huge crowds. It’s a great way to meet new people and test your limits. For example, the Safe Summer campaign encourages people to stay active while being mindful of the heat.

Social Fitness Events and Festivals

Think outdoor yoga sessions at sunset, beach boot camps, and themed runs through the city. These social fitness events are popping up all over the UAE. They combine exercise with entertainment, creating a festival-like atmosphere that appeals to a wide range of people. It’s not just about working out; it’s about having a good time with friends and family. These events often feature healthy food vendors, live music, and other activities, making them a full day of fun.

Local Fitness Hubs and Meetups

Local fitness hubs are becoming increasingly popular. These are community spaces where people can come together to exercise, learn new skills, and connect with like-minded individuals. They might offer a range of classes, from traditional gym workouts to more specialized activities like rock climbing or martial arts. The key is that they provide a welcoming and inclusive environment where everyone feels comfortable. Meetups are also a great way to find people who share your interests, whether it’s running, cycling, or even just walking.

It’s amazing to see how fitness is evolving from a solo pursuit to a social activity. People are realizing that working out with others can be more motivating, more enjoyable, and ultimately, more effective. The community aspect adds a whole new dimension to the fitness experience, making it something that people look forward to rather than dread.

Sustainable and Eco-Conscious Practices

It’s cool to see how much the fitness scene here is changing. People are really starting to care about the environment, and that’s showing up in how they work out. It’s not just about getting fit anymore; it’s about doing it in a way that’s good for the planet too.

Eco-Friendly Gyms and Studios

More gyms are popping up that are all about being green. They’re using things like recycled materials for the floors and equipment, and they’re super energy-efficient. It’s a big change from the old-school gyms that seemed to waste energy like crazy. Some are even generating their own power with solar panels. Plus, they’re cutting down on plastic by using refillable water stations and encouraging members to bring their own bottles. It’s a win-win: you get a good workout, and you’re helping the environment.

Outdoor Workouts Utilizing Natural Spaces

People are ditching the treadmills and heading outside. Why be stuck inside when you can get a workout with a view? There’s been a big increase in outdoor fitness classes in parks and natural reserves. It’s a great way to connect with nature while getting your sweat on. Plus, it’s usually free or low-cost, which is always a bonus. I saw a group doing yoga in a park last week, and it looked way more relaxing than being in a stuffy studio.

Sustainable Activewear Choices

What you wear to work out matters too. More brands are making activewear from recycled materials like plastic bottles and fishing nets. It’s not just about being eco-friendly; these materials are often really comfortable and durable. Plus, buying sustainable activewear sends a message that you care about the environment. I just got a pair of leggings made from recycled plastic, and they’re honestly the best I’ve ever owned.

It’s awesome to see the fitness community embracing sustainability. It shows that people are thinking about the bigger picture and making choices that are good for the planet. Hopefully, this trend will continue to grow and inspire even more people to get involved.

Specialized Training for Diverse Needs

It’s not just about general fitness anymore; people want programs tailored to their specific life stage or abilities. In the UAE, this trend is really taking off. We’re seeing a surge in demand for fitness solutions that cater to everyone from seniors to young athletes, and even expecting mothers.

Senior Fitness Programs

Senior fitness is booming. It’s all about maintaining mobility, balance, and strength to help older adults stay independent and active. These programs often include:

  • Low-impact exercises like walking and swimming
  • Strength training with light weights or resistance bands
  • Balance exercises to prevent falls

Youth Sports Development

Forget just running around a field. Youth sports development is getting serious, with a focus on proper training techniques, injury prevention, and overall athletic development. It’s not just about winning; it’s about building a foundation for a lifetime of fitness. The London Sport Institute Dubai is a great example of this.

Pre and Postnatal Exercise

More women are recognizing the importance of staying active during and after pregnancy. These specialized programs focus on safe and effective exercises to support a healthy pregnancy, prepare for labor, and recover postpartum. It’s all about listening to your body and working with qualified professionals. Here’s a quick look at some common exercises:

Trimester Exercise Examples
First Walking, swimming, prenatal yoga
Second Modified planks, squats, pelvic floor exercises
Third Light cardio, stretching, relaxation techniques

It’s important to remember that every pregnancy is different, and it’s crucial to consult with a doctor or qualified fitness professional before starting any exercise program during or after pregnancy. They can help you create a safe and effective plan that meets your individual needs and goals. Also, consider wearable devices to track your progress.

Home-Based Fitness Solutions

Home workouts are getting a serious upgrade here in the UAE. Forget just doing some jumping jacks in your living room; we’re talking about tech and tools that bring the gym experience right to your house. It’s all about convenience and personalization, especially with the crazy schedules people have these days.

On-Demand Workout Platforms

Think of it like Netflix, but for fitness. These platforms are booming, offering everything from quick HIIT sessions to long yoga flows. The cool thing is the variety. You can find classes in Arabic, English, and even some in other languages to cater to the diverse population here. Plus, many platforms are starting to partner with local instructors, so you get that community feel even when you’re sweating it out solo. I tried one last week, and it was surprisingly motivating!

Smart Home Gym Equipment

Smart home gym equipment is becoming more popular. We’re not just talking about treadmills anymore. Now you can get interactive mirrors that guide you through workouts, bikes that simulate real-world rides, and weight systems that adjust automatically. The price point is still a barrier for some, but more affordable options are starting to pop up.

Personalized Virtual Coaching

Want a personal trainer but don’t want to leave the house? Virtual coaching is the answer. You get one-on-one sessions via video call, and your trainer can create a custom workout plan based on your goals and fitness level. Some coaches even use wearable data to track your progress and adjust the plan accordingly. It’s like having a pocket-sized fitness guru!

I think the biggest draw of home-based fitness is the flexibility. You can work out whenever you want, without having to worry about gym hours or commute times. It’s perfect for busy professionals, parents, or anyone who just prefers to exercise in the comfort of their own home. Plus, with all the tech advancements, you can get a really effective workout without ever stepping foot in a gym.
